  Samsung Unveils Wireless MP3 Player

By Mendelson Tiu | Tuesday | 16/10/2007

Samsung has recently unveiled its T10 MP3 player, an 8mm thin MP3 player that comes with a two-inch LCD screen, has Bluetooth capabilities, and has an enhanced battery life.

Samsung's T10 MP3 player
Samsung also claims that its MP3 player brings together all of the modern applications consumers look for in an MP3 player including video player, FM radio, photo album, voice recorder, text reader, and up to 30 hours battery life for music or four hours of video.

Samsung is also offering consumers complete freedom from wires with its Bluetooth functionality and claims to even support two Bluetooth headsets and earphones simultaneously so that three people can listen to music or watch movie footage at the same time.

In addition, the T10 has touch-sensitive controls that illuminate once the player is turned on and an animated user interface makes the menu fun and simple to navigate. The T10's preset equaliser allows consumers to customise their personal settings. Moreover, various music files like MP3, WMA and OGG audio files are supported through the T10's Digital Natural Sound engine (DNSe) surround sound system, which guarantees a more natural experience by optimising sound quality, the company says.
